Coniscliffe Close - BR7 5NW
Key Street Insights
Coniscliffe Close is a residential street with 11 addresses.
It ranks as the 87th largest and 101st most expensive of the 255 streets in the BR7 area. The most common property type is a modern house built after 1980.
The street contains a total of 11 properties: 8 houses and 3 other properties.

Sales Market Trends
The last sale on Coniscliffe Close sold for £623,700 on 29th November 2024. Since then prices are up an average of 0.9%.
The current average value in the street is £747,546.
The Coniscliffe Close Sales Market has increased by 19.8% over the last 10 years.
| Period | Year on Year | Average Price |
|---|---|---|
| June 2026 | -0.1% | £747,546 |
| June 2025 | 2.6% | £748,328 |
| June 2024 | 0.2% | £729,073 |
| June 2023 | -3.1% | £727,356 |
| June 2022 | 7.5% | £750,506 |
| June 2021 | 6.9% | £698,027 |
| June 2020 | 3.3% | £653,064 |
| June 2019 | -0.9% | £632,338 |
| June 2018 | -0.5% | £638,045 |
| June 2017 | 2.8% | £641,443 |
| June 2016 | 7% | £624,206 |
| June 2015 | 7.5% | £583,104 |
| June 2014 | 19.6% | £542,206 |
| June 2013 | 5.4% | £453,439 |
| June 2012 | 1.4% | £430,295 |
| June 2011 | 8.3% | £424,505 |
| June 2010 | 11.5% | £392,123 |
| June 2009 | -11.4% | £351,728 |
| June 2008 | 1.5% | £396,788 |
| June 2007 | 0% | £391,062 |
